Transaction 75c5da997df5ccba27046d3a41e738b3dfbc3575dae2dbb1ae23589d7d6aa061
3 Input
2 Outputs
- 75c5da997df5ccba27046d3a41e738b3dfbc3575dae2dbb1ae23589d7d6aa061:0
- 75c5da997df5ccba27046d3a41e738b3dfbc3575dae2dbb1ae23589d7d6aa061:1
value 1507298
address 1Cpz4Y3dXAsSM851b9WjD3tgFTN1rSPhHV
value 16500000
address 33gvT8xXSc5pN5woYKdkAPLP3wYzKUd7fP